Specializes in psychological and neuropsychological evaluation of intellectual disability; acquired brain injury and dysfunction (TBI, stroke, etc.); neurodegeneration (Alzheimer’s and other dementias); neurodevelopmental abnormalities (fetal exposure to alcohol, lead, etc.); toxic exposures (lead, insecticide, substance abuse); and PTSD. Dr. Acheson also has experience working with Veterans. He utilizes an evidence based approach incorporating state of the science techniques and instruments in both criminal and civil court settings to address a variety of forensic questions. He serves most of central and western North Carolina with offices in Asheville and Sylva, NC. He is available in eastern NC and throughout the country as time permits.
